Once your Google AdWords campain is up and running, you will first need to deactivate the content network application. The purpose of this feature is to permit Google to show your AdWords ads the websites of partners such as MySpace, Squidoo and Ezinearticles. The reason behind shutting the content network capability off is that you will not get as many interested visitors as you will from the advertisements that show up solely in Google’s search lists. For example, if your landing page is specifically created to collect contact details (like e-mail addresses) from your visitors, the ones who do come to your site from the content network will probably not subscribe as easily as those who come in from search results. So it just makes sense to save your money and turn off the content network. You can check out the content network when you have a huge testing budget to play with advertising. But, for right now, stay with the search results only.
If you truly want success in AdWords and do well with ClickBank, you ought to target just the long tail keywords that are relevant to whatever merchandise you are advertising. When a potential customer is conducting a search for a product or service, they will often type a word into the Google search field. I’m sure it’s definitely not “gardening” or “sports”. When you know exactly what you want to purchase, you’re going to use search terms that are as explicit as possible. Even more specifically, if you want to buy a “purple Dell laptop” or a “pink Logitec mouse” you would just type that exact phrase into Google. Lest someone should type in an arbitrary keyword like “gardening” for their Google search, they are probably not searching for a gardening eBook, but something similar to the content of the text itself.
You also need to be more specific in your keywords and phrases in order to get the most out of your AdWords traffic and apply it effectively to your ClickBank product sales.
